Vivian Ayala
Project Manager

Vivian joined Candelaria Design in July 2000. She graduated from University of Puerto Rico, where she is from, with a Bachelor Degree in Environmental Design and obtained her Master Degree in Architecture at Arizona State University. In addition to her cheerful personality, her bi-lingual skills and ability to multitask various projects are other qualities cherished by Candelaria Design. Vivian enjoys spending family time with her husband Paco and seven year old daughter Gabrielle.

Patrick Banks
Project Manager

Patrick joined Candelaria Design in July 2004. After earning a bachelor of architecture degree at the University of Arkansas in 1996, he moved to Boston, Mass. where he worked several years with a large firm on a variety of project types. He eventually found his niche in high-end residential design. “I am passionate about my work; I want clients to be inspired to passion.”

Jeff Kramer
Project Director

Jeff joined Candelaria Design as a Project Director in September 2000. After graduating with a bachelor of architecture from Tulane University, he spent the next 15 years with a local Phoenix firm, Knoell & Quidort Architects, as a Project Architect where he developed his skills on a wide variety of commercial and residential projects. Jeff joined CDA because of his enjoyment of working on quality residential architecture exclusively. He states, "Residential architecture provides an unmatched opportunity for personalized service and collaboration with clients in the creation of an inspiring and uniquely customized home.

Meredith Thomson
Project Manager

Meredith is a Phoenix native who recently moved back from San Francisco. She attended the University of Notre dame and graduated in 2003 with a Bachelors in Architecture. Her fourth year as a student was spent traveling throughout Italy and Europe, fueling her passion for traditional design. She was also fortunate to spend a summer in Chicago interning with Liederbach and Graham Architects which helped her discover her calling to be a residential architect. After graduation, she went to work with Fairfax and Sammons Architects in New York City, where she spent three years working on projects in and outside of the city; including a townhouse in the West Village and a summer home in Long Island. Missing home on the west coast she decided to start making her way back, and ended up with a position at Peter Pennoyer Architects; a New York based firm that has a sister office in San Francisco. From there she transitioned into the interior design world, working for Tucker and Marks Interior Design as an interior architect. She recently made the final jump back to Phoenix ~ Spring of 2013 and aside from coming 'home', is very excited to be a part of the Candelaria Design team!

Bob Vieracker
Project Manager

Bob Vieracker, AIBD, joined Candelaria Design in August 2007 as a Project Manager. Originally from Chicago, Bob has more than 20 years of custom residential design experience primarily in the Midwest, but also on the Florida Gulf Coast. His most recent experience includes working on the exclusive resort communities around the mountains in Flagstaff. After graduating with Bachelor degrees in Architecture and Interior Architecture from Lawrence Technological University in Suburban Detroit, Bob worked for a variety of interior designers, architects and builders before starting up his own design firm and homebuilding company in 1995 in Michigan. For 11 years as chief designer, licensed builder and owner of both companies, he engaged in custom home projects of all sizes for both new and renovated homes. Bob enthusiastically looks forward to the challenges and opportunities presented in designing homes in the Southwest and the new relationships forged with clients, fellow design associates, and the trades ahead.
